嵌入式系统设计与开发专业知识嵌入式工程师的核心技能
什么是嵌入式工程师?
嵌入式系统设计与开发专业知识
嵌入式工程师是一种特殊的软件工程师,他们专注于在硬件设备中运行的软件系统。这些系统可以从简单的微控制器到复杂的大型工业自动化设备都有可能。因此,想要成为一名成功的嵌入式工程师,你需要具备扎实的计算机科学和电子技术基础。
嵌入式工程师报考条件是什么?
要想成为一名合格的嵌入式工程师,你首先需要了解其报考条件。这通常包括对计算机编程语言、操作系统、网络通信协议以及硬件组装和调试等方面有一定的理解和技能。在大学期间,学习相关课程如数字逻辑、微处理器原理、实时操作系统等是非常重要的。
如何准备成为一名优秀的嵌入式程序员?
为了准备好成为一名优秀的嵌入式程序员,你应该从基础开始构建你的知识体系。首先,要熟悉至少一种编程语言,如C或C++;其次,要掌握基本的心理学原理,因为在设计用户界面时,这一点尤为关键。此外,对于不同类型的手持设备(如智能手机)和消费级电子产品(如智能家居设备)的应用也非常重要。
实践经验对于提升技能至关重要吗?
当然了!理论知识固然重要,但没有实际操作经验的话,你将无法真正地掌握如何解决问题。在学校或个人项目中积累实际工作经验也是必须要做的事情。你可以参与开源项目,或是在朋友圈里寻找机会来实践你的技能。
聚焦特定领域以展现专业能力
随着科技发展,各种各样的新兴领域不断出现,比如物联网(IoT)、人工智能(AI)以及大数据分析等。如果你能聚焦于某个特定领域,并且深造,那么你就能够更好地展现自己的专业能力,并且在职场上脱颖而出。例如,在物联网领域内,您可能会专注于传感器数据处理或者智能家居控制台开发。
在哪些行业可以找到工作机会?
由于嵌本质上的跨越性,它们被广泛应用在许多不同的行业,从医疗保健到汽车制造再到金融服务业,都有着巨大的需求。而具体来说,一些常见地点包括:半导体公司、中小企业、高科技公司甚至政府机构及军事部门等。选择正确职业方向取决于你的兴趣爱好和所追求的地位目标,同时也应考虑市场需求情况。
能够持续学习新技术是怎样一种挑战?
作为一个快速变化并且不断进步的事业范畴,能够持续学习新技术是一个既激励又具有挑战性的过程。一旦你进入了这个行业,就不再只是单纯跟随流行趋势,而是要主动去探索新的工具、新框架、新平台,以及最新最前沿的一切信息。这不仅要求你保持好奇心,还需要有很强的问题解决能力,以便有效融合这些新工具与已有的知识库进行创新性思维输出。此外,与同行交流分享也是一种极好的方式,可以帮助自己更快适应这一快速变化环境中的最新趋势与发展方向。